Real Estate Contracts Need Clarity and Consistent Quality
Real estate deals involve detailed timelines, disclosures, financing contingencies, and specific performance obligations. When something goes wrong—like a refusal to close, delayed repairs, or disputed earnest money—the consequences can be significant. Disputes often turn on what the real estate contract attorney contract requires, how deadlines are defined, and whether a party properly provided notice. A real estate-focused approach can help ensure that your position is grounded in the contract and supported by documentation.
A trustworthy attorney also understands that quality representation includes clear communication and realistic expectations. You should be able to see how your evidence connects to the contract terms and the legal standards that apply to your claim. That means organizing records like signed agreements, amendments, emails, inspection reports, repair invoices, and correspondence about notice requirements. With a strong foundation, you can pursue remedies such as specific performance, damages, or recovery of amounts wrongfully withheld.
